A historic rum distillery that was once owned by British sugar merchant, Tate & Lyle, before being nationalised by the Trinidadian government in the 1970s. It eventually closed in 2003 and the last of the distillery's stock and its brand name were acquired by Italian distributor, Velier.
A brand of independently bottled rum and Scotch whisky, produced for and marketed by the Italian distributor, Cuzziol. Released in the early 2010, its rum range included a variety of interesting single cask releases that included closed distilleries such as Uitvlugt, Enmore and Caroni.
A long-serving Italian distributor and wholesaler, founded by Renzo Cuzziol in 1955. Originally dealing primarily in food and locally-produced beers, subsequent generations have introduced high-end wine and spirits to the company portfolio. The latter was spun-off into Cuzziol Grandivini in 2015.
